The percentages you see are the percent chance of assimilation (if you read the stone it tells you that and tells you what assimilation is).

Assimilation is the change in some attribute other than the attribute you were wanting to change.

ex. You want to add STR to an item and the assimilation is 30%. There is a 30% chance that some other attribute (anything listed on the item) will change no matter if the STR stone succeeds or fails. You want stones with a 10% assimilation.

The assimilation percentage has nothing to so with the rate of success or fail of the stone.
